Task Force on Statistical Significance and Replicability Created
An ASA Task Force on Statistical Significance and Replicability will be created, with a charge to develop thoughtful principles and practices that the ASA can endorse and share with scientists and journal editors.
ASA Task Force on Sexual Harassment and Assault Provides Summary Report
In an effort to proactively address issues around sexual misconduct and gender discrimination, the ASA Board of Directors approved the formation of the Task Force on Sexual Harassment and Assault at their November 2017 meeting and appointed members from a cross-section of the ASA membership. This is a summary of the task force’s findings.
